Arrest warrant had been issued: First statement from Enes Batur
YouTuber Enes Batur, for whom an arrest warrant was issued as part of a drug investigation conducted in Istanbul, has made a statement via social media.
A major investigation into drug trafficking and use has been launched under the coordination of the Istanbul Anatolian Chief Public Prosecutor's Office. The operation targeted social media influencers, musicians, and comedians.
During the dawn raid conducted yesterday, 11 people, including famous comedian Hasan Can Kaya, popular singer Reynmen (Yusuf Aktaş), and rap musician Emirhan Çakal, were detained. However, these individuals were later released.
STATEMENT FROM ENES BATUR
Following the arrest warrant issued against him as a result of the operation, YouTuber Enes Batur made a statement on social media, expressing that he has no connection to the drug investigation. Stating that he has been abroad for approximately 25 days to produce content, Batur made the following statement:
“I do not have clear information as to whether this is an investigation that concerns me. I am abroad for video shoots, and at the end of this process, I will provide the necessary cooperation within the legal framework in my country. I request that misleading and unverified information not be given credence.”
